There are many reasons why the Omni16R should be considered when the time comes to replace those rack based legacy alarm systems. One of the major benefits, besides being a fast and cost effective upgrade/replacement solution is the increased reliability that it provides. Most rack based legacy alarm systems rely on a single CPU, causing complete loss of the alarm system in the event of a CPU failure. However, the Omni16R does not rely on a single CPU and each Omni16R alarm card is a standalone 16 point alarm annunciator in its own right, with its own processor and watchdog, eliminating complete loss of the alarm system due to a single CPU failure.
The system is based around the successful Omni16C alarm annunciator logic, cleverly re-packaged into a 19” rack mount version (up to 320 alarm points in a rack). The technology used is identical to the Omni16C (providing the benefit of many years of field experience), which has also been Emphasis assessed for use in the UK nuclear industry. Omni16R is a proven upgrade path for 19” rack mount legacy alarm systems.
